Showing 32,581 - 32,600 results of 33,659 for search '"Open Access"', query time: 0.11s Refine Results
32581
32582
32583
32584
32585
32586
32587
32588
32589
32590
32591
32592
32593
32594
32595
32596
32597
32598
32599
32600